The South Dakota lending rules that reach Belvidere
This table holds the South Dakota rate and licensing rules for consumer loans made to Belvidere's 42 residents.
| Rule | Detail | Source |
|---|---|---|
| State lending regulator | South Dakota Division of Banking (Department of Labor and Regulation) Source says: "The Division of Banking is charged with the regulation and supervision of state chartered and licensed financial institutions." | South Dakota Division of Banking (Department of Labor and Regulation) as of 2026-09-16 |
| Initiated Measure 21 anti-evasion rule (state-specific rule) | Initiated Measure 21 (2016) also bars evasion by indirect means; applies to loans originated, refinanced, rolled over, renewed or flipped after November 15, 2016. Source says: "prohibits these money lenders from evading this rate limitation by indirect means... a loan made in violation of this measure is void" (Division of Banking guidance on Initiated Measure 21). | South Dakota Division of Banking (Department of Labor and Regulation) as of 2026-09-16 |
| Maximum legal interest rate (usury cap) | No general maximum/usury restriction when the rate is set by written agreement; specific caps elsewhere in the code apply (e.g., 36% for licensed money lenders). Source says: "no maximum interest rate or charge, or usury rate restriction... if they establish the interest rate or charge by written agreement" (SDCL 54-3-1.1). | South Dakota Legislature (South Dakota Codified Laws) as of 2026-09-16 |
